Among the 900 mutations associated with a CF disease phenotype, the G551D mutation is the third most common one with a frequency of 2±5%, depending on the population of origin (Hamosh et al., 1992; Cashman et al., 1995). Login to comment

G551D, localized in NBD1 of CFTR, interferes with ATP binding (Logan et al., 1994) and hydrolysis (Li et al., 1996). Login to comment

Here we show that low concentration of genistein (25 lM) di€erentially activates wild type or G551D-CFTR channels depending on whether the protein is phosphorylated before or after genistein interaction with CFTR. Login to comment
110 ABCC7 p.Gly551Asp
X
ABCC7 p.Gly551Asp 12181609:110:144
status: NEW
view ABCC7 p.Gly551Asp details
When forskolin was added after genistein preincubation, (1) whole-cell current density was reduced by $ 3-fold (for wild type) and $4-fold (for G551D), (2) time to activation was greatly delayed, and (3) time constant of activation was reduced when compared with genistein activation after phosphorylation of CFTR.
